Rangers FC formed in 1872 and the side was named after an English rugby team that the founders had been casually reading about in a book. The club was one of ten original members of the Scottish Football League and the Gers won the very first Scottish title in 1891. However, Rangers had to share this honour with Dumbarton, as the two clubs won the same number of points and then drew a play-off title decider. By the time the new Scottish Premier League formed in 1998, Rangers FC was one of just three original league clubs to make it into the top ten sides; the other two teams were Celtic and Hearts FC. In total, the Gers have won over fifty league titles and over fifty domestic cups. With such a staggering list of honours, it is no surprise that Rangers FC is considered to be the most successful football club in Scotland.

The Personalised Rangers Calendars begin back in 1930, when the Gers beat Partick Thistle 2-1 in the Scottish Cup final replay. By the 1960s the club had become dominant in this competition, winning the Cup five times in that decade alone. In 1964, the Gers' 3-1 victory against Dundee United also secured a 'treble' for the club, as Rangers had already won the League Cup and the Scottish Championship. In 1966, Rangers enjoyed another special win, as the team lifted the trophy by defeating the club's fierce rival Celtic FC in a replay filled with tension.
1972 was the Gers' centenary year and Rangers beat Dynamo Moscow 3-2 at the Nou Camp to win the European Cup Winners' Cup. A pitch invasion by Rangers' fans meant that the trophy ceremony took place in a small room inside the stadium. During the seventies, the Gers also won two 'trebles' in the space of three years. In 1976, Rangers clinched their third trophy by beating Hearts FC 3-1 in the Scottish Cup final. In 1978, the club beat Aberdeen in both cups before defeating Motherwall 2-0 to clinch the Scottish Championship.

In 1987, Rangers drew 1-1 with Aberdeen to finally end a drought that had seen the 'New Firm' briefly dominate. Order was restored for the club and they soon went on an incredible run to make up for lost time. In 1997, Rangers beat Dundee United 1-0 to win their ninth consecutive league title. The Gers also became Scottish Premier League Champions in 2005, following a 1-0 victory against Hibernian.
